Copying onto Various Types of Paper

You can copy onto various types of paper, such as envelopes, transparencies, thin paper, and thick paper.

Select a paper type according to the weight or type of the paper you are using.

Important

  • The Duplex function cannot be used if you are using Paper Weight 9. If the Duplex function is specified, press [1 sided 2 sided:TtoT] to cancel the setting.

You need to specify the type of paper you are using in [Tray Paper Settings] to make copies using paper from the paper trays, LCT, or the wide LCT.
